Linking Information Systems to Business Performance.

The lack of understanding of the relationship between process and platform is a key contributor to the extreme spending on information management systems and technology in organizations today.  Many managers are quick to adopt a technology to solve their organizational needs without clearly understanding the underlying business process beforehand.  It is often seen that these systems are installed and cannot accomodate the current workflow.  For example, they can create new processes, but not faciliate existing ones. 

What advice can you offer on the alignment of information systems and process to achieve business performance?
